BMPS 2026 Last Chance: 16 Teams, 2 Spots, 14 Eliminations
The BMPS 2026 Last Chance Stage runs June 13-14 at Nodwin Gaming Arena, Delhi. 16 teams play 12 matches for 2 Grand Finals spots, with 14 teams eliminated.
The BMPS 2026 Last Chance Stage opens today, June 13, at the Nodwin Gaming Arena in Delhi, with sixteen squads fighting through twelve matches for two remaining seats in the Grand Finals. The two-day stage is the final filter before the Jaipur LAN and carries no second chance. Only the top two teams survive, and the other fourteen are eliminated from the Pro Series.
The stage sits in front of a ₹4 crore prize pool and a slot at the PUBG Mobile World Cup (PMWC) 2026 in Paris, both of which go to the eventual champion. Sixteen teams that survived the Semifinals without a direct Grand Finals ticket are now playing one of the shortest high-stakes brackets in Indian BGMI. The defending champions are one of those sixteen, and they enter in seventh place.
The Two-Day Filter That Cuts 16 Teams to 2
The format is short and zero-sum. 16 teams play twelve matches across June 13 and 14, six matches each day. The top two teams in the cumulative standings advance to the Grand Finals. The remaining 14 eliminated from BMPS 2026, with no third-place playoff, no resurrection bracket, and no wildcard.
The Grand Finals that follows is a 16-team event, with 8 teams from Qualifiers Group A, 6 from the Semifinals, and 2 from the Last Chance Stage playing 18 matches over 3 matchdays at the Jaipur Convention Center from June 19 to 21. The 16 Teams and What They Bring Into the Last Chance
Every team here is a 7th-to-22nd finisher from the Semifinals, which means the field is wider than the gap between them suggests. Defending champion Team AX sits at the top of the Last Chance pack on 118 points; WindGod, the 22nd seed, comes in on 63. A single hot day can close a 55-point spread; a single cold day at the top can hand the bracket to a 21st seed.
The Semifinals ran 16 matches per team in a round-robin across three groups, and the standings show how tightly clustered the Last Chance field is. Eight teams finished within 14 points of each other (from 7th at 118 down to 14th at 104), and the next eight were within 37 points (from 15th at 100 down to 22nd at 63). Below them, Team Versatile (55) and White Walkers (54) were the two teams eliminated from the Pro Series, two points apart, both falling off the bottom of the bracket. The points were earned across four days of play at the Nodwin Gaming Arena, with placement and elimination totals stacked into a single table. Three teams from the Semifinals podium (Nebula Esports, Myth Official, Revenant XSpark) are not in this stage; they qualified directly for the Grand Finals through the top six. The team that topped the Survival Stage earlier in the tournament, Jelly-led Team Apex Gaming, is in the Last Chance field after an 18th-place finish with 86 points. Here is the full field:
| Team | Semifinals Finish | Points | Semifinals Group |
|---|---|---|---|
| Team AX (defending champions) | 7th | 118 | B |
| Lastade Esports | 8th | 117 | C |
| Rapid Chaos | 9th | 114 | C |
| Team Tamilas | 10th | 111 | B |
| Wyld Fangs | 11th | 110 | A |
| Zero Ark | 12th | 109 | A |
| 4TR Official | 13th | 108 | B |
| Autobotz | 14th | 104 | B |
| MYSTERIOUS 4 | 15th | 100 | B |
| Meta Ninza | 16th | 91 | B |
| Welt Esports | 17th | 90 | A |
| Team Apex Gaming | 18th | 86 | C |
| Higgboson | 19th | 84 | B |
| Rising Esports | 20th | 70 | B |
| True Rippers | 21st | 65 | C |
| WindGod | 22nd | 63 | C |
The Defending Champions Are in the Same Boat
Team AX won BMPS 2025. They came into the 2026 Semifinals with the kind of form that suggested a direct qualification was the base case, not the ceiling. A brilliant start put them in the upper half of the table. A poor run on Day 4 dropped them slipped to seventh on 118 points, one slot above the Last Chance cut and 12 points below the last direct-qualification spot.
Their last-chance campaign begins from seventh on the Semifinals points table, with 117-point Lastade Esports and 114-point Rapid Chaos just below them, two teams that also missed the Grand Finals cut by a small margin. The defending champions are not in unfamiliar company at the top of the Last Chance pack. The bracket offers no room for another slow Day 4.
Other familiar names face the same arithmetic. Shadow-led Meta Ninza sat comfortably in the upper half of the Semifinals leaderboard through the first two days before slipping to 16th with 91 points. Jonathan-owned Team Apex Gaming came into the Semifinals off a top finish in the Survival Stage but finished 18th with 86 points. Punk-led True Rippers and WindGod were the bottom two survivors into the Last Chance, on 65 and 63 points respectively, and the only teams that came out of the Semifinals in single-digit Chicken Dinner territory.
The bottom of the field knows the math. WindGod is 55 points behind the 7th seed they share a bracket with, and in a stage that scores a maximum of 10 placement points plus eliminations per match, that gap is not the lead it sounds like over 12 matches.
What the Two Survivors Win
The Last Chance pays only in survival. Its prize is a seat at the Grand Finals, where the field, the ₹4 crore prize pool, and the international slot all wait together. The 16-team Jaipur event carries a PMWC 2026 Paris spot for the champion.
Fourteen teams are already locked in for that Grand Finals. Eight of them qualified directly through Qualifiers Group A, the top of the long online road that ran from May 6 to 31. Six more joined them through the Semifinals top six, Aadi-led Nebula Esports on 150 points, Myth Official on 139, Revenant XSpark on 136, Reckoning on 135, Genesis Esports on 130, and Gods Reign on 120. The 8 Grand Finals teams from Qualifiers Group A:
- GodLike Esports
- iQOO 8Bit
- iQOO Soul
- Vasista Esports
- Divine Gaming
- iQOO Orangutan
- Victores Sumus
- 7Gods Esports

The Semifinals That Put Them Here
The Semifinals ran 24 teams across 3 groups, A, B, and C, in a double round-robin that produced 16 matches per team over four days, June 9 to 12, at the Nodwin Gaming Arena. Aadi-led Nebula Esports topped the bracket with 150 points and two Chicken Dinners, the same finish line that earlier powered them through the Survival Stage qualifying. Myth Official finished second with 139 points and two Chicken Dinners. Revenant XSpark moved into third with 136 points and one Chicken Dinner on a strong final day.
The bottom two, Team Versatile on 55 points and White Walkers on 54, are out of BMPS 2026. The two teams they finished just above in the Last Chance field, WindGod (63) and True Rippers (65), were the only squads that entered the Last Chance stage having been in single-digit Chicken Dinner territory in the Semifinals. Frequently Asked Questions
When is the BMPS 2026 Last Chance Stage?
June 13 and 14, 2026, at the Nodwin Gaming Arena in Delhi. Six matches are played on each of the two days, for a total of 12 matches across the stage.
Where is the Last Chance being played?
The Nodwin Gaming Arena, Delhi. It is the same offline venue that hosted the BMPS 2026 Semifinals from June 9 to 12. The Last Chance, Semifinals, and Grand Finals are the three offline stages of the tournament.
How many teams advance from the Last Chance to the Grand Finals?
The top 2 of 16. The remaining 14 teams are eliminated from BMPS 2026 with no third-place match and no further qualification path.
What does the BMPS 2026 champion win?
A share of the ₹4 crore prize pool and a slot at the PUBG Mobile World Cup (PMWC) 2026 in Paris go to the eventual champion. The Grand Finals at the Jaipur Convention Center run from June 19 to 21 with 18 matches across 3 matchdays for the 16 teams that reach it.
How can I watch the BMPS 2026 Last Chance live?
Live streams run on the Krafton India Esports YouTube channel in English and Hindi starting at 3:30 PM IST. The first match of each day kicks off at 4:00 PM IST, and the Day 1 map order opens on Rondo before rotating through Erangel and Miramar.
